Department of Mathematical Sciences Course Catalogue 2025/26
USMA-AFM30: MMath(Hons) Mathematics
Route: MMath(Hons) Mathematics
Leading to the award of MASTER OF MATHEMATICS
Mode of Attendance: Full-time
Normal course duration: 4 Years

DACS and exit awards: | USMA-AFB30: BSc(Hons) Mathematics is the designated alternative course (DAC).
Transfer to DAC is possible in years 1 or 2 if co-existent master's progression threshold is not met.
Exit awards:
BSc(Hons) Mathematics. Overall course average: weighted stage 1 0%, stage 2 32%, final stage 68%
Diploma of Higher Education
Certificate of Higher Education
Course Transfer information:
All undergraduate (including undergraduate Masters) courses in the Department of Mathematical Sciences are in the same Course Family due to the high degree of commonality between available units in Stages 1 and 2. Students who have transferred between courses within a particular Course Family will only be permitted one further attempt at a stage that they have already taken.
|
Weighting towards final award by stage: | Stage 1: 0% Stage 2: 16% Stage 3: 34% Final Stage: 50% |

Students must choose at least two of blocks 1 to 3 (List A) and at least one of blocks 4 to 6 (List B) as listed below.
- Block 1: MA22032 Analysis 2A + MA22033 Analysis 2B (15 credits)
- Block 2: MA22014 Statistics 2A + MA22015 Statistics 2B (15 credits)
- Block 3: Applied (MA22016 Differential Eqns and Vector Calculus; MA22021 PDEs) (15 credits)
- Block 4: MA22038 Probabilistic modelling + MA22039 Probability theory (15 credits)
- Block 5: MA22020 Advanced linear algebra + MA22017 Groups and rings (15 credits)
- Block 6: Numerical analysis alone (10 credits)
Students must take a total of 60 credits across the year with at least 25 credits of MA units in each semester. |
